Popular Conversions at a Glance
| Category | Common Examples |
|---|---|
| Length | 1 m = 3.281 ft · 1 km = 0.621 mi · 1 in = 2.54 cm |
| Weight | 1 kg = 2.205 lbs · 1 g = 0.035 oz · 1 lb = 0.454 kg |
| Temp | 0°C = 32°F · 100°C = 212°F · 0°C = 273.15 K |
| Volume | 1 L = 0.264 gal · 1 gal = 3.785 L · 1 cup = 236.6 ml |
| Speed | 100 km/h = 62.14 mph · 1 m/s = 2.237 mph |
| Data | 1 GB = 1024 MB · 1 TB = 1024 GB · 1 KB = 1024 B |

Mass is the amount of matter in an object (measured in kg, g, lb), while weight is the force of gravity on that mass. In everyday usage, they're often used interchangeably. Our converter handles both metric (kg, g) and imperial (lb, oz) mass units.
Select "Temperature" category, enter your Celsius value, choose "Celsius" as the from unit and "Fahrenheit" as the to unit. The formula is: °F = (°C × 9/5) + 32. For example, 0°C = 32°F and 100°C = 212°F.
